Don Cheadle will narrate The Wonder Years reboot

March 29, 2021 by Gary Collinson

Having cast young actor Elisha ‘EJ’ Williams in the lead role, the upcoming reboot of The Wonder Years has now found its adult Dean Williams, with Don Cheadle set to serve as narrator of the upcoming reboot.

Written by Saladin Patterson and directed by Fred Savage, the original series’ Kevin Arnold, the single camera pilot takes place during the same timeframe as the classic 80s comedy-drama and follows 12-year-old Dean Williams, an inquisitive and hopeful kid coming of age in a turbulent time in 1960s Montgomery, Alabama.

Along with Williams and Cheadle, the pilot features Dulé Hill and Saycon Sengbloh star as Dean’s parents and Laura Kariuki as his teenage sister. Patterson and Savage are executive producing with Lee Daniels, while the original series’ co-creator Neal Marlens serves as a consultant.

Cheadle has earned multiple Emmy and Golden Globe nominations for his TV work, which includes Showtime’s House of Lies and Black Monday. He’ll next be seen on the big screen in Warner Bros.’ Space Jam: A New Legacy.
